Content online is limitless, with blogs, magazine article sites, social media, and rating sites. No longer do beer drinkers have to rely on monthly beer magazines that can sugarcoat a story to appease an advertiser. Strongly opinionated bloggers provide some of the main enjoyment online, talking about beer in a way others haven't, or are too scared to. On the other hand, you may think the blog writer is weak in his or her knowledge.

Articles on topics like the best 150 places to drink beer are free to read and you can comment on their choices. This is pure beer porn pleasure: to compare your thoughts with other beer lovers. Some of the best parts of blogs are the comments from various readers who either agree or disagree. With every review or post there are going to be those who dissent and have their own opinion. Which is the beauty of the internet.

User Generated Content

The whole idea behind every website is content. Whether it is our own  Blogcritics, Facebook, pr anything else, every website is looking for increased traffic through increased content. The X-rated websites have been the leaders for many years but are now being overtaken by social media sites.

Whether it is beer, food, or wine, each has a class in the "porn" genre for the pure enjoyment of consumers who love to look at that specific content. 

The inspiration for this article came upon reading through some pages on 1001 Beers you must try before you die. Flipping through a book on beer, without knowing what the next page brings, is where the term "beer porn" comes from. The sheer pleasure of reading about beer and viewing pictures definitely makes this author thirsty.
